L.S.,

Ik heb een eenvopudige tabel waarbij de kleuren van de cellen in een matrix staan
echo "<table border=2 cellpading=2 cellspacing=2>";
for ($irow=0; $irow <= $teller; $irow++)
{
print "<tr>";
for ($ikol=0; $ikol <= $teller+2; $ikol++)
{
echo "<td width='100', bgcolor="'.$cell_color[$ix][$iy].'", align='center'>", $matrix[$irow][$ikol], "</td>";
}
print "</tr>"; // "<td width=\"".$kolom_breedte."\">".$item."</td>\n";
} //\"".$cell_color[$ix][$iy]."\"
echo "</table>";

De waarden van cell_color zijn white, green en red
Maar het werkt niet.....
Iemand een idee?

Alvast dank
ik denk $ix vervangen door $irow en $iy vervangen door $ikol
Dank voor je reactie, dat klopt. Was voor debuggen gedaan.
De melding die ik krijg bij:
echo "<td width='100', bgcolor="'.$cell_color[$irow][$ikol].'", align='center'>", $matrix[$irow][$ikol], "</td>";

is:
Parse error: syntax error, unexpected T_CONSTANT_ENCAPSED_STRING, expecting ',' or ';'

Dus ik denk dat ik iets verkeerd doe met quotes, maar weet niet wat...
Gebruik de php tags om je code heen dan zie je de kleurtjes.

<?php
// jouw regel
echo "<td width='100', bgcolor="'.$cell_color[$irow][$ikol].'", align='center'>", $matrix[$irow][$ikol], "</td>";
// mijn regel
echo '<td width="100" bgcolor="' . $cell_color[$irow][$ikol] . '" align="center">' . $matrix[$irow][$ikol] . '</td>';
?>
>", $matrix[$irow][$ikol], "</
De , moeten een . zijn

En wat SanThe zegt
Hartelijk dank SanThe en de anderen, super..
Ex tnks voor het begrip dat ik zulke simpele vragen stel..

Reageren